How do you Subtract Fractions 13/12 and 7/6?
The given fractions are 13/12 and 7/6
Firstly the L.C.M should be done for the denominators of the two fractions 13/12 and 7/6
13/12 - 7/6
The LCM of 12 and 6 (denominators of the fractions) is 12
2 | 12, 6 |
3 | 6, 3 |
2, 1 |
So the lcm of the given numbers is 2 x 3 x 2 x 1 = 12
= 13 x 1 - 7 x 2/12
= 13 - 14/12
= -1/12
Result: -1/12
